WebAnswer (1 of 2): The rider sits with the shoulders, back and seat facing straight forward. The rider’s legs are held in place by the pommels. The rider’s left foot is in the stirrup, and their left thigh under the lower pommel (also called the leaping head). Saddling Generally, you saddle from the left or near side, but your horse should accept saddling from either side. Stand slightly behind the shoulder of the horse and place the saddle pad or blanket, with the fold facing front, just behind the horse’s shoulder blades ...

WebSide saddle was the traditional way for a lady to ride – it was impractical to ride astride because ladies wore long skirts. Male grooms even rode side saddle to keep the horses fit for their lady owners.
